Transaction 2c9572e12d55e390af6f17fb8824f0f40173089d1451839d94fea2c506fb3f13

1 Input
2 Outputs
  • 2c9572e12d55e390af6f17fb8824f0f40173089d1451839d94fea2c506fb3f13:0
  • value  244957515
    address  39ShQyaudE3GECLYZQZAjMpcGY5aePcZ21
  • 2c9572e12d55e390af6f17fb8824f0f40173089d1451839d94fea2c506fb3f13:1
  • value  28035407
    address  1EkqaS3iasnfYK2X9QvQptmhHDuYiqroez